Location: Irma Colen Health Center in Mar Vista

Duration: 6 months minimum

Schedule: Two four-hour shifts, Preferably Tuesday / Wednesdays afternoons and any time on Fridays morning (Fridaycould be all day); Possibility of some outreach events outside of regular schedule

ROLE DESCRIPTION

Administrative

- Scan Consent forms into patient’s electronic dental records (EDR)

- Scan Parent Screening/Feedback Forms and all reports into patient’s EDR

- Scan or fax records to Schools

- Assemble dental supply kits

Identify patient’s records in both EDR and Dexis

- Check spelling of patient name to avoid duplicating charts/files

- Sync patient’s MRN #s with Dexis to avoid duplicating charts/files

Confirm VDH dates with preschools

- Appointment reminders for patients to be seen on treatment days,

call school one week prior and confirm schedule/patient list

Confirm VDH dates with parents

- Call the parents and let them know the children will be seen the next week

Mission Statement

To improve the health of people and communities through accessible, quality care.

Description

Over the past 50 years, Venice Family Clinic’s mission of providing quality primary health care to people in need hasn’t changed, but its scope has broadened dramatically. Today, the Clinic has about 400 staff members and more than 1,300 volunteers who serve 28,000 patients, without regard for their ability to pay or immigration status. Its programs have expanded beyond primary medical care to include dental, vision, behavioral health, exercise classes, health education, early childhood development - and street medicine for people experiencing homelessness, to ensure even the most vulnerable of its neighbors get the medical care they deserve.

Our Volunteer Services Department strives to recruit and connect the best volunteers possible with almost every department within the clinic. We work to provide support to the volunteers as well as the clinic teams whom they help. Every year, we work with over 1400 volunteers, including approximately 500 provider volunteers. Our department helps with recruiting, training, scheduling, and general upkeep of all volunteers.
